Mesothelioma Lawsuit

Asbestos victims may make a mesothelioma claim [browse around this website] as an individual injury claim or wrongful death case. The outcome of a lawsuit is contingent on a variety of factors including the statutes of limitation in each state as well as asbestos litigation experience.

Mesothelioma lawyers who are experienced have access to databases containing information about asbestos manufacturers as well as the places where asbestos was used. They also know when to seek compensation from trust funds set up by asbestos manufacturers that have gone bankrupt.

Compensation

Many mesothelioma law firms sufferers have a myriad of difficulties in overcoming the disease. They may be required to pay for expensive treatment and lose their income if they are disabled to work. The diagnosis of mesothelioma often comes with a heavy emotional burden. Fortunately, victims and their families can claim compensation from asbestos companies responsible for their exposure.

Mesothelioma lawsuits can offer victims significant compensation to cover current and future medical expenses, lost wages and suffering and pain. The amount of a settlement or jury verdict can vary depending on each individual case. In the majority of cases victims also receive punitive damages as well as compensatory damages.

The severity of a patient's mesothelioma and the expected prognosis plays a major role in the amount of compensation given. The court also takes into account the age of the patient and other factors such as how much they've lost in earnings.

Certain victims can qualify for benefits that go beyond the mesothelioma settlement. These funds were created by the federal government to help victims of asbestos-related illnesses.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ist a client in filing for these benefits.

Once a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, the process of gathering evidence begins. During depositions and discovery prior to trial lawyers representing the plaintiff typically uncover evidence of the defendant's negligence. This may include records showing that the company knew about asbestos' risks and did not disclose it to workers. Additionally, mesothelioma lawyers will look over any other evidence relevant to the case like the victim's employment history, medical records, and witness testimony. These evidences are used to help make the case stronger, and increase the chances of a positive outcome.

Damages

Mesothelioma victims and their families can receive compensation for physical, financial and emotional damages. Compensation could include future treatment costs. The amount of damages will vary according to a variety of factors. A mesothelioma lawyer will assist you in constructing a strong case to get the maximum amount of compensation.

Once a lawsuit is filed the lawyers of both sides will share information and evidence via a process called discovery. This may include in-person and written depositions, also known as interviews. A mesothelioma attorney can help you prepare for these meetings, and help you understand their impact on settlement negotiations.

The defendants often offer minimal settlement amounts for mesothelioma in order to avoid the cost and public exposure of a court trial. A top lawyer will work to ensure that their client receives adequate compensation even if it means bringing the case to trial.

The jury will decide on the amount of compensation family members or victims deserves when a mesothelioma case goes to trial. The amount is determined by a range of different elements that include the place and duration of exposure, the severity of their asbestos-related illness, and whether they have dependents.

The financial burdens associated with mesothelioma law, asbestos-related diseases and others can be overwhelming. Victims and families may have to stop jobs to concentrate on caring for or treatment, resulting in lost income and mounting debt. Mesothelioma lawsuits take into consideration the financial strains during settlement negotiations in order to ensure that victims receive a an equitable amount of compensation.

Victims could also be entitled to punitive damage if the defendants show malice or gross negligence. These damages could be worth millions of dollars.

Taxes

Asbestos victims should be aware of how their mesothelioma compensation and other compensation is taxed. A tax attorney or certified professional can assist victims in determining which portion of their awards are taxable and how they can avoid tax penalties.

In mesothelioma cases the court awards compensatory damages which include monetary compensation to cover medical expenses and lost wages, emotional distress and more. Additionally, certain mesothelioma plaintiffs receive punitive damages for the at-fault asbestos company's disregard for the safety of its workers.

The amount of a mesothelioma settlement depends on the strength of the case. A good case will typically include medical records, work history and evidence of exposure to asbestos. A defendant's ability to pay is also a significant element.

Asbestos lawyers can negotiate the most lucrative compensation for their clients. They will try to negotiate mesothelioma settlements that covers the expenses of the plaintiff and takes account their family's needs. A mesothelioma lawyer will look at the financial requirements of the plaintiff which include medical care and living expenses.

It is often best for asbestos sufferers to opt for a mesothelioma claim settlement rather than a trial verdict. Trial verdicts are a risky proposition which leave the decision in the hands of the jury, which could award large amounts or small amounts. Settlements in mesothelioma cases are generally more favorable than trials and permit victims to receive compensation earlier.
